Lin Jianshen used his seven years of youth to become the most silent shadow behind Qin Yu. From falling in love at first sight in college to working side by side in the business world, he remembered all Qin Yu's preferences, silently took care of all the trivial matters, and hid his love in every moment that no one knew about. Qin Yu was concerned about family marriage and took this contribution for granted. Until the eve of his engagement with Xu Qingrang, Lin Jianshen was diagnosed with a terminal illness and quietly left Switzerland.
This secret love in the background of a wealthy family hides the cruelest time difference - when Lin Jianshen was passionately in love, Qin Yu turned a blind eye; when Qin Yu suddenly woke up after marriage, Lin Jianshen had exhausted his life on a snowy night in a foreign country. Xu Qingrang's business marriage was not malicious, but it became the last straw that broke the relationship. Her guilt and struggle added a complicated footnote to this tragedy.
Lin Jianshen left 365 letters, recording seven years of deep love and pain. The last sentence was only "Qinyu, it's snowing, but I can't wait for spring." Qin Yu chased to Switzerland, only to find an empty snow and a lifetime of irreparable regrets. From then on, he guarded a ginkgo forest and died alone.
This is a cruel lesson about love and miss. There is a short-term sweetness hidden in the glass slag, and in the end, only belated awakening and eternal regret remain.
